Output 03f0c112e06a58058dd1000b70c0f5239008411ed78455c44c76e15ab77c3b9b:0

value
170426415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a755d7f420c7d6dcd3bbf21ec6c9a79e599be13 OP_EQUAL
address
MMyrtehKBJCKYBtsEYXisTpgs4wawtr4pw
transaction
03f0c112e06a58058dd1000b70c0f5239008411ed78455c44c76e15ab77c3b9b
spent
true